Is it OK to open the oven when baking a cake?

During baking, don’t open the oven door during the first half of cooking time as this can cause cakes to sink. If cakes are over-browning, cover loosely with foil. Bake until golden and a skewer inserted in the centre of cake comes out clean.

What happens if you open the oven while baking a cake?

We know the temptation to check on your cake is high, but we’re here to give you one of our top tips: don’t open the oven when baking. This is a common mistake, and can cause your cake to collapse because the rush of cold air stops your caking from rising.

Is it bad to open oven while cooking?

We’re not saying it’s OK to continually open the oven door when you’re cooking (you’ll lose heat and lower the oven temperature) — and, all right, you shouldn’t open it at all if you’re making a soufflé — but in all other instances it’s OK to open the oven door once, halfway through a food’s cook time.

What do you think the reason why we don’t open the oven while baking?

THE FIX: Opening the oven door causes cold air to rush into the oven, dropping the temperature and interfering with the rise of your baked goods. It’s best not to open the door until the baked goods have fully risen and you’re ready to check doneness (ideally a few minutes before the recipe’s specified time).

Does opening the oven lose heat?

Opening the door will probably initiate a heat cycle as quickly as the controls can respond and temperature will not be out of the desired range for very long. The temperature loss from opening the door can increase cooking times for 2 to 4 minutes.

Can I cover cake with foil while baking?

If a cake is overbrowning, then the oven temperature could be too hot, as the cake cooks from the outside in, burning the outside before the middle cooks. … Or you could loosely cover the cake top with foil to protect it (only for last half of cooking time – the cake does need to create a crust first).

Can you open oven door when baking bread?

Baking Process

The heat of the oven transforms the moisture in the bread dough into steam causing the bread to rise rapidly. … The oven door should not be opened before this stage is completed.

Does bread sink if you open the oven?

If you open the oven door, the pressure created from the heat is released. The moisture and hot air fly! If the pressure gets released before the crust has formed the bread will collapse like a cake does in the same scenario.

What happens if you don’t Preheat the oven?

When you don’t preheat, you cook your food at a lower temperature as your oven heats up for the first 5-15 minutes, depending on the target temperature and your oven’s strength. … Beyond under-browning, you’ll also run into problems like lack of rising in steam-leavened foods.

Does oven waste a lot of electricity?

Most electric ovens draw between 2,000 and 5,000 watts, with the average electric stove wattage coming in at around 3,000 watts. So how much energy does an electric stove use per hour? Assuming an electricity rate of 12 cents per kilowatt-hour (kWh), a 3000-watt oven will cost you about 36 cents per hour at high heat.
